AHA announces recipients of 2023 Rural Hospital Leadership Team Award 

AHA Dec. 20 announced the leadership team from Queen’s North Hawaii Community Hospital, a 35-bed rural acute care hospital in Waimea, Hawaii, as the recipient of the association's 2023 Rural Hospital Leadership Team Award.

GAO recommends FDA, CISA update medical device security documentation based on AHA input

The Government Accountability Office Dec. 21 recommended the Food and Drug Administration and Cybersecurity and Infrastructure and Security Agency update a 5-year-old agreement regarding medical device security.

CDC study finds low rates of COVID-19, flu and RSV vaccinations in adults 

A CDC study released Dec. 21 found low COVID-19 and flu vaccination coverage for most adults, and low RSV vaccination coverage for adults aged 60 and older.

CMS proposes additional Medicare appeals processes 

The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services Dec. 21 issued a proposed rule to provide additional appeals processes for Medicare beneficiaries in certain circumstances.

DOJ disrupts ALPHV/Blackcat ransomware group

The Department of Justice announced Dec. 19 the launch of a disruption campaign against a ransomware group that has targeted the computer networks of more than 1,000 victims, including networks that support critical U.S. infrastructure.
